Feedings
A dog's feeding routine is a fundamental part of their overall health and wellness. Look for a childcare that follows your pet dog's normal consuming routine, specifically if they are on an unique diet plan or have various other dietary restrictions.
A well-run day care facility will certainly offer a healthy and balanced mix of activities for your pet dog. Including day-to-day walks, play, and agility exercises can aid your pet burn power and improve their cardiovascular fitness.
Ask the day care exactly how often they supply group play and if they have any type of regulations for dog-to-dog communications. Excessive interaction can leave pet dogs feeling drained pipes and overwhelmed, so it is very important to find the best equilibrium. For many pet dogs, the sweet place is 2-3 days of daycare per week. This gives appropriate socializing without overstimulation.

Rest Periods
Dogs require to relax from skipping with their peers at the very least a couple of times a day. This is to avoid overstimulation and physical exhaustion. A reliable daycare facility will certainly use them time to relax and charge.
Throughout the interview process, ask about the center's pause. They ought to supply crates and/or different spaces for pet dogs to take a break from the action. Additionally, be sure to inquire about the center's safety measures and staff-to-dog proportion.
Daily pet daycare is a wonderful way to keep your pup literally and socially promoted, but it's important to assess whether your pet can handle regular playdates or needs more area to extend their legs in your home. Ask your veterinarian and a relied on pet treatment service provider to establish the very best daycare timetable for your canine.
